On Class, Race, and Educational Reform serves as a catalyst for engaging and thought-provoking discussions among Marxists, critical race theory scholars, and other educational theorists who are dedicated to addressing racism and class inequalities. The book begins with a compelling lead chapter authored by Howard Ryan, a doctoral student with a background in teaching and labor organizing. This chapter delves into the core issues of class, race, and educational reform, raising thought-provoking questions and stimulating insightful responses from educational theorists from diverse countries.
In response to the opening chapter, these theorists offer valuable insights and perspectives, highlighting both the differences and similarities in their viewpoints. Their responses demonstrate how educators can bridge theoretical divides and collaborate internationally to develop educational campaigns of solidarity that effectively counter the harmful effects of racism and class inequalities in the classroom and beyond.
The book is enriched by a Foreword by Stephen Brookfield (University of St. Thomas, USA) and an Afterword by Cheryl Matias (University of Kentucky, USA). These contributions provide additional depth and perspective to the discussions, further enhancing the book's value as a resource for educators and scholars seeking to understand and address these critical social issues.
